Eco Volunteer Up: Animal rescue in the Amazon, Ecuador

This project was founded in 2006 in partnership with a local indigenous family that lives on rainforest land. 

The project rescues and rehabilitates wild animals from the jungle that were often illegally captured for sale to tourists or were injured or mistreated by their owners. This placement is ideal for people interested in biology, animal rights, conservation, and environmental policy, Remote but beautiful, the property teems with its talkative residents: parrots, monkeys, turtles, wild cats, and other mammals who call the verdant, lush green surroundings of this idyllic tropical location home.

Main volunteer activities:

- feeding animals

- clean enclousers

- plant, clean and pick fruits and vegetables

- collect insects for certain animals

You will have a wonderful time in this project , knowing local people and from different countries, hike around the forest, take baths in the small lagoon. 

The program fee : 

US$ 225 registration fee includes: Quito pick up airport, orientation, 24 support, a night with a host family Quito including breakfast and dinner, transfer from host family to bus station Quito, pick up bus station in Puyo, cordinator will pick up in Puyo and take you to the project. 

US$ 100 per week accommodation and three meals per day.
